I am british can I get a china visa while I am touring new zealand

I was told you cant get a china visa three months before you go and we shall then be in New Zealand so can I get it there

The embassy suggests that the applicants submit their applications one month in advance before they go. If possible, better apply for it and get it before you leave GB. If you plan to apply for it in a third country, you should have resident permit for employment or study there.
